用户提问: ai生成路径
Ai回答: AI生成路径通常指的是利用人工智能技术来规划、优化或生成某种路径或路线。这种技术可以应用于多个领域,如自动驾驶、物流配送、机器人导航、游戏AI、路径规划算法等。以下是AI生成路径的一般流程和关键技术:
1、问题定义
明确路径生成的目标,例如:
从起点到终点的最短路径。
避开障碍物的最优路径。
动态环境中的实时路径规划。
确定输入数据,如地图、障碍物位置、起点和终点等。
2、数据准备
收集或生成环境数据(如地图、障碍物信息)。
将数据转换为AI模型可处理的格式(如图像、网格、图结构等)。
3、选择算法或模型
传统算法:
A*算法:基于启发式搜索的最短路径算法。
Dijkstra算法:适用于无权重图的最短路径搜索。
RRT(快速随机树):用于高维空间的路径规划。
机器学习方法:
强化学习:通过奖励机制训练AI学习最优路径。
深度学习:使用神经网络预测路径或优化路径规划。
混合方法:结合传统算法和机器学习,提高效率和鲁棒性。
4、训练与优化
如果是基于机器学习的方法,需要训练模型:
使用历史数据或模拟环境进行训练。
调整超参数以提高模型性能。
对于传统算法,优化启发式函数或搜索策略。
5、路径生成
根据输入数据和算法,生成从起点到终点的路径。
考虑动态因素(如移动障碍物、实时交通信息)进行实时调整。
6、评估与验证
评估生成路径的质量,如路径长度、时间消耗、安全性等。
在模拟环境或实际场景中测试路径的可行性。
7、应用与部署
将生成的路径应用于实际场景,如自动驾驶车辆、无人机导航、物流配送等。
持续监控和优化路径生成系统。
应用场景
自动驾驶:生成车辆行驶路径,避开障碍物和交通拥堵。
物流配送:优化配送路线,减少时间和成本。
机器人导航:在复杂环境中规划移动路径。
游戏AI:为游戏角色生成智能移动路径。
无人机飞行:规划无人机飞行路线,避开禁飞区和障碍物。
工具与框架
编程语言:Python、C++、Java等。
库与框架:
传统算法:NetworkX、OpenCV。
强化学习:TensorFlow、PyTorch、OpenAI Gym。
路径规划:ROS(机器人操作系统)、MoveIt。
通过AI生成路径,可以显著提高路径规划的效率和智能化水平,尤其是在复杂和动态的环境中。
0
IP地址: 202.168.232.148
搜索次数: 0
提问时间: 2025-04-21 20:19:57
热门提问:
易方达中证全指证券公司指数(LOF)
ai图片重绘
详细介绍域名www.catl.hk.cn的含义、价值与适合的行业。
万德股份
ai平台有哪些
友情链接:
香港搜尋引擎
サーチエンジンプログラム